To start the phlebotomy certification procedure requires attending an accredited educational program or being trained on the job. A phlebotomist is trained in the exercise of drawing blood for testing and performing transfusions.
In addition to the NPA, agencies that certify phlebotomy nominees contain the American Credentialing Agency, the American Society for Clinical Pathologies Board of Certification, American Medical Technologists, the National Center for Competency Testing, as well as the National Healthcareer Association. Bailey Students who register for this program will learn the newest phlebotomy processes, including prevention of pre-analytic errors in the lab, skin puncture and blood collection, special procedures, legal situations in phlebotomy, electrocardiograph and vital signs, venipuncture, basic medical terminology, ways to complete challenging draws, collection gear, anatomy, physiology, and customer service abilities. As stated by the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P), phlebotomy technicians in America brought in an average yearly salary of $24,350.
